lakehead student overcomes personal challenge and creates award to help others

(oct. 7, 2011 - orillia, on) just six years ago, robert moore was an alcoholic and drug addict who had barely survived seven years of homelessness, 16 years of being in and out of jail, and dangerous associations with organized crime.

moore, in his second year of the honours bachelor of social work (hbsw) program at the orillia campus, recently celebrated six years of sobriety since turning his life around in september 2005.

his remarkable story is documented in moore's recently self-published book, there's moore to life. the book is a compelling account of the struggles moore faced on his self-destructive path that began at a young age, and the incredible transformation he has made.

moore's transformation journey began the day he checked himself into a detox centre. this pivotal step led to a three-month stay at the seven south treatment centre in orillia, which moore describes as a life-altering learning process. "it gave me the tools to learn how to live in the community," he says, "and also allowed me to return to school."

while completing his high school education at the orillia learning centre, moore enrolled in an online drug and alcohol counselling program, and began taking courses in the social services worker diploma program at georgian college. moore's motivation to pursue additional studies came from his own life experience. "i saw how drugs and alcohol affected my life and i figured that i might be able to help other people."

the desire to help others is also what made moore decide to write his book. "my goal is to give back to the community and help support someone who can't help themselves. this is why i wrote the book - to reach out to those who need it. by sharing my struggles and hopes, i hope to help prevent others from going down the wrong road."

"i originally set up the award with the funds raised from a garage sale i held in the spring," explains moore. "my experience at 阿根廷vs墨西哥竞猜 has been very positive," says moore. "my college diploma gave me a good foundation and prepared me to come here, but this degree is what i need. i'm getting valuable experience and will gain the qualifications i need to accomplish my goals."

moore looks forward to continuing his work in the local community. he plans to remain in the orillia area to work with local youth and hopes to one day open a crisis centre or group home.

in the meantime, moore will be busy promoting his book, raising funds for the robert j. moore award, and completing his degree.
